503(b)(9) Claim definition
503(b)(9) Claim means a Claim or any portion thereof entitled to administrative expense priority pursuant to section 503(b)(9) of the Bankruptcy Code.
503(b)(9) Claim means any Claim against any of the Debtors for the value of goods sold to the Debtors in the ordinary course of business and received by the Debtors within twenty (20) days before the Petition Date, which qualifies as an administrative expense pursuant to 11 U.S.C.
503(b)(9) Claim means a Claim for payment of administrative expense of a kind specified in section 503(b)(9) of the Bankruptcy Code or any other claim that was incurred before the Petition Date and is purportedly entitled to administrative priority treatment whether pursuant to section 503(b) or otherwise other than any Indenture Trustee Fees and Expenses.
